Summary
The Liv Intrigue is a versatile trail bike praised for its balanced geometry, highly tunable suspension, and confident yet playful handling. It excels in a variety of conditions, from technical climbs to fast descents, though some reviewers noted it lacks the stiffness for the most aggressive riding. The bike's women-specific design and range of sizes have been highlighted as strengths, alongside its modern aesthetics and practical features like integrated mudguards.
Balanced geometry and highly tunable suspension
Confident yet playful handling
Women-specific design with a range of sizes
Modern aesthetics and practical features
Lacks stiffness for the most aggressive riding
Short travel dropper post and weak brakes in some models
Some components may not meet expectations for the price

| Frame | Advanced-Grade Composite front triangle, ALUXX SL-Grade Aluminum rear triangle Tire Clearance: 2.6" Color: Metallic Red / Black |
|---|---|
| Fork | Fox 36 Float Performance Elite, 150mm travel, FIT4 Damper, Boost 15x110mm KaBolt, tapered steerer Travel: 150mm Spring Type: Air |
| Shock | Fox Float DPX2, Performance, trunnion mount Travel: 140mm |
| Bottom Bracket | SRAM GXP Dub Press Fit |
| Headset | OverDrive, integrated |
| Stem | Giant Contact SL 35, 35mm |
| Handlebar | Giant Contact SL TR35, 780x35mm, 20mm rise |
| Saddle | Liv Contact SL (forward) |
| Seatpost | Giant Contact Switch S dropper post with remote lever, 30.9mm Type: Dropper |
| Pedals | N/A |
| Rear Derailleur | SRAM GX Eagle |
|---|---|
| Front Derailleur | N/A |
| Crank | TruVativ Descendent 6k Eagle Dub, 30 |
| Shifters | SRAM GX Eagle, 1x12 |
| Cassette | SRAM GX Eagle, 10x50 |
| Chain | SRAM GX |
| Chain Guide | None |
| Brakes | SRAM Guide RS [F] 180mm [R] 180mm, hydraulic disc Type: SRAM Guide RS Hydraulic Disc |
| Brake Levers | SRAM Guide RS |
| Rims | Giant TRX 1, 30mm inner width, 27.5 hookless carbon WheelSystem |
|---|---|
| Spokes | Sapim |
| Front Hub | Level 2 hubs (F) Boost 15x110mm, (R) Boost 12x148, XD Driver body |
| Rear Hub | Level 2 hubs (F) Boost 15x110mm, (R) Boost 12x148, XD Driver body |
| Tires | [F] Maxxis High Roller II 27.5x2.5 WT, 60 tpi, 3C, EXO, TR, tubeless, [R] Maxxis high Roller II 27.5x2.4, 60 tpi, EXO, TR tubeless |
